Who is a useful owner?
A “advantageous owner” is any person who, straight or indirectly, (i) workouts significant control over a reporting business or (ii) owns or manages a minimum of 25 percent of the ownership interests of a reporting business. The 25 percent test is reasonably simple, but considerable control requires looking at the specific facts and scenarios, such as the degree to which the individual can manage or influence crucial choices or functions of the reporting company.
The company offered numerous circumstances and responses to the feedback it received in the Final Rules, along with additional assistance, to help services in grasping the concept of substantial control. In the meantime, “considerable control” is broadly specified. A private exercises substantial control over a reporting company if the person:
Acts as a senior officer;
Has authority over the visit or removal of any senior officer or a majority of the board of directors (or comparable body);.
Directs, determines or has considerable influence over crucial decisions; or.
Has any other type of considerable control.
FinCEN provides further guidance such that a person might directly or indirectly workout significant control through:.
Board representation;.
Ownership or control of a majority of the ballot power or ballot rights;.
Rights associated with any financing plan or interest in a company;.
Control over one or more intermediary entities that independently or collectively workout significant control over a reporting business;.
Arrangements or monetary or organization relationships, whether official or informal, with other people or entities functioning as candidates; or.
Any other contract, arrangement, understanding, relationship or otherwise.
There is no optimum variety of beneficial owners a reporting business should divulge.
There are also a couple of exceptions depending on the kind of useful owners. For instance, if the beneficial owner is a minor child, that truth will get kept in mind on the report, but the determining data for that small kid does not require to be consisted of. Nevertheless, once that child reaches the age of majority, an upgraded advantageous ownership report must be sent with the kid’s details.
If a specific only has a future interest in a reporting business through a right of inheritance, they will not need to be included. There are also specific rules for intermediaries or others who are acting upon another’s behalf (i.e. a candidate or custodian).
What information must be reported?
If an entity is a reporting company and does not fall within among the exemptions, it must submit a BOI Report. The BOI Report should consist of the following information:
For the Reporting Company:.
Full legal name and any trade name or “operating as” (DBA) name;.
Present US address of its primary workplace or existing address where it conducts organization in the US, if its principal workplace is outside the US;.
Jurisdiction of formation or registration; and.
Internal Revenue Service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) (consisting of a Company Identification Number (EIN)) or a tax recognition number issued by a foreign jurisdiction and the name of such jurisdiction if the foreign reporting company has actually not been released a TIN.
For each Business Candidate and each Beneficial Owner:.
Full legal name;.
Date of birth;.
Existing residential address, no P.O. boxes (Company applicants who form or sign up business in the course of their company ought to report the business street address.); and.
Distinct identifying number and providing jurisdiction from an appropriate identification document (i.e. United States passport, driver’s license) (this could be a identifier number or something like a passport number or chauffeur’s license number).
Illegal stars frequently use corporate structures such as shell and front companies to obfuscate their identities and launder their ill-gotten gains through the United States. Not just do such acts undermine U.S. nationwide security, they also threaten U.S. economic prosperity: shell and front business can shield useful owners’ identities and permit crooks to illegally access and negotiate in the U.S. economy, while disadvantaging little U.S. services who are playing by the rules. This rule will enhance the stability of the U.S. financial system by making it harder for illegal actors to use shell business to wash their cash or hide assets.
The current has actually highlighted the vulnerability of corporate structures to exploitation by, positioning a significant risk to both United States nationwide security and the stability of the worldwide monetary system. The 2022 Russian intrusion of Ukraine, for example, exposed the attempts of Russian oligarchs, state-controlled services, and arranged criminal offense groups to utilize shell business in the United States and abroad to prevent sanctions. It is anticipated that it will cost reporting companies with easy management and ownership structures– which expects to be the majority of reporting business– roughly $85 each to prepare and submit a preliminary BOI report. In contrast, the state formation cost for creating a limited liability business (LLC) can cost in between $40 and $500, depending on the state.

The guideline explains who should file a BOI report, what information needs to be reported, and when a report is due. Specifically, the guideline requires reporting business to file reports with FinCEN that identify two categories of people: (1) the advantageous owners of the entity; and (2) the company applicants of the entity.
The last rule reflects’s mindful factor to consider of comprehensive public remarks received in action to its December 8, 2021 Notice of Proposed Rulemaking on the very same subject, and substantial interagency assessments. received comments from a broad variety of individuals and organizations, consisting of Members of Congress, government authorities, groups representing small company interests, corporate transparency advocacy groups, the financial market and trade associations representing its members, police agents, and other interested groups and people.
Balancing both benefits and problem, the following are the key elements of the BOI reporting guideline:.
Reporting Business.
The rule recognizes 2 types of reporting business: domestic and foreign. A domestic reporting company is a corporation, restricted liability business (LLC), or any entity produced by the filing of a document with a secretary of state or any similar office under the law of a state or Indian tribe. A foreign reporting business is a corporation, LLC, or other entity formed under the law of a foreign nation that is signed up to do business in any state or tribal jurisdiction by the filing of a document with a secretary of state or any comparable office. Under the rule, and in keeping with the CTA, twenty-three types of entities are exempt from the meaning of “reporting company.”.
expects that these meanings mean that reporting companies will consist of (subject to the applicability of specific exemptions) restricted liability collaborations, restricted liability limited collaborations, service trusts, and a lot of restricted partnerships, in addition to corporations and LLCs, because such entities are typically produced by a filing with a secretary of state or similar workplace.
Other types of legal entities, consisting of specific trusts, are left out from the meanings to the extent that they are not developed by the filing of a document with a secretary of state or similar workplace. recognizes that in numerous states the development of most trusts generally does not involve the filing of such a development file.

So you should know by now that the Corporate Transparency Act requires that all companies that are filed with the secretary of state to report their beneficial owners.
Well, this hit a snag last Friday in Alabama.
well, you see the National Service Association, which was among the plaintiffs that brought this case challenging the constitutionality of the law, got a federal court to declare that the act is unconstitutional in discovering that Congress, you know, really exceeded its bounds by mandating organizations to report their beneficial ownership info or what we describe as the BOI.
Now, the court mentioned that in spite of acknowledging the Act’s honorable objectives versus the cash laundering, it still had to strike it down, specifying that there’s no precedent allowing Congress such substantial powers over services simply since they’re included.
You know, the federal government, you understand, they threw whatever they had at this one, too.
They said, Hey, we’ve got foreign affairs powers, we have the Commerce provision, we have taxing authority.
However the court didn’t buy any of it, citing cases in stating that Congress has other ways to achieve these objectives without the overreaching element of the CTA.
Actually, all of it come down to constitutional limits.
This court stressed that while the goals to neutralize financial criminal offenses are good, there are lines that Congress simply can not cross.
Therefore what does this mean to you?
If you’ve been fretted about the CTA and having to apply to FinCEN to get your FinCEN ID number?
Well, you still need to do it since regrettably in this case it was limited simply to the plaintiffs of that case.
Undoubtedly, FinCEN has acknowledged the choice and has granted refrain from executing it on the mentioned complainants.
So if you belong to the Small company Association, hey, that’s a win for you.
If you’re not, what does it indicate for us?
Well, ultimately other plaintiffs are going to select this up, and I bet we’re going to see more cases hitting within the next couple of months, challenging this law.
